Roof leak need advise

Brad Swaney
  • Investor
  • Lima, OH
Posted

Have a roof leak and had two different company’s do repairs with no luck yet. Side of roof that is leaking has no bathroom vents or chimneys. Just shingles on the side that it’s leaking.

1st company took off ridge cap. Has box vents on other side of roof for venting.

2nd company caulked shingles that where loose.

Anyone ever had any luck repairing roof? vs replacing?

Shingles look to be in good shape. Roofing companies said I should get another 5-7 years. Only leaks during a hard rain.

Also if replacing I was thinking of doing a metal roof. I feel like they will last longer. What’s your thoughts on a metal roof?
